Recognizing the Bail Process
The Bail procedure stands for a crucial junction of justice and individual legal rights, allowing offenders the possibility to protect their launch from safekeeping while awaiting test. This process begins when an individual is arrested, and a judge identifies the Bail quantity based on numerous factors, including the intensity of the claimed criminal offense and the defendant's trip risk. Defendants or their reps can then come close to bail bond services to aid in safeguarding the necessary funds. It is important to understand that Bail is not a resolution of guilt however a way to assure the charged's presence at future court procedures. Effective navigating of this procedure can have significant ramifications on the offender's life, affecting their capacity to prepare a defense and keep specialist and personal responsibilities.

Co-Signer Responsibilities and Options
Co-signers play an important duty in the bail bond procedure, providing economic assurance to the bail bond agent. Their main duty is to assure the full Bail quantity in situation the defendant stops working to get redirected here show up in court. This obligation implies that co-signers have to have a stable earnings, good credit report, and a clear understanding of the economic threats involved. Additionally, co-signers are typically needed to provide security, such as building or cash money, to protect the bail bond. They also maintain communication with the bail bond agent, ensuring that all problems of the bond are met. Ultimately, co-signers should consider their options very carefully, as their financial security might be at risk if the offender does not satisfy their legal commitments.

Frequently Asked Inquiries
Just How Do Bail Bond Representatives Figure Out the Premium Quantity?
Bail bond representatives generally identify the premium quantity based on several factors, consisting of the accused's danger degree, the crime's seriousness, and the possibility of appearing in court, guaranteeing they balance their financial threat and company viability.
Can I Bail A Person Out Without Knowing Their Costs?
Inquiring whether one can bail a person out without knowing their costs, it is generally recommended to get that details. Comprehending the costs aids in determining the Bail quantity and possible threats entailed in the procedure.
What Occurs if the Defendant Breaches Bail Conditions?
Consequences might include retraction of Bail, arrest, and prospective added charges if the accused breaks Bail conditions. The court might also impose more stringent problems or raise the Bail amount for future launch possibilities.
